1
我試着測試組件undecorator,但我沒有得到。如何在AVA上使用@decorator(redux-connect)測試組件undecorator?
實施例:
import React, { Component } from 'react'
import { connect } from 'react-redux'
@connect(({ user }) => ({ user }))
export class Componente extends Component {
render() {
return <div>hello {this.props.user}</div>
}
}
實施例試驗:
import test from 'ava'
import Component from './Component'
import { mount } from 'enzyme'
test('<Component />', t => {
let wrapper = mount(<Component />) // the connect's redux create a wrapper component :(
})
它是可以測試的成分未修飾?怎麼樣?
裝飾者是一個*建議*,他們不是ES7的一部分。 –